




版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
1、精品文档8086微型计算机系统考试题目答案一、填空题(每空1分,共20分)1、 微型计算机硬件系统可分成为 CPU、存储器 和I/O 接口三大模块,模块之间通过 总线 连接而成。在系 统与输入/输出设备之间,必须通过I/O接口相连接。2、目前计算机系统主要有两种体系结构,它们分别是冯诺依曼 和哈弗,有更高运行效率的是哈弗。3、已知 X=68, Y=-12,若用 8 位二进制数表示,则X + Y补=50H 此时,CF=_0 _; X 丫补=38H/56D , OF=_0_4、8086 CPU的基本总线周期包含了 4个T状态。5、 I/O端口地址有两种编址方式,它们分别是独立编址 和 存储统一编址
2、 ;接口电路中,输入端口必须具有缓 冲功能,而输出端口必须具有锁存功能。6、硬件中断可分为可屏蔽中断和非屏蔽中断两种。7、8086/8088 CPU响应可屏蔽中断的条件是_IF=1。8、 通用微型计算机的CPU由 _微处理器、*储器以及I/O接口电路_组成,8086CPU按照结构有_EU和 BIU _2个独 立的处理部件组成。9、 计算机最常用的数据编码是补码,若机器字长为8位,则十进制数-128的补码是10000000B ;若有带符号数X=01H Y=81H则由计算机作8位减法运算X-Y后,累加器中的数是10000000B ,借位标志CF= 1、符号标示SF=_1_ 溢出标志OF=_ 1丄由
3、此可判断结果真值应为-12810、8086/8088 CPU在RESET!号到来后其 CS和IP的值分别为_ FFFFH和0000H。11、CPU与外设传送数据时,输入/输出控制方式有无条件方式 _ , _ 查询方式_ ,中断方式 和_ DMA方式。12、8086 CPU响应一个可屏蔽中断请求时,将向外设发送两个中断响应脉冲,通过数据总线读入中断类型码。13、INTEL 8253采用BCD码计数时,其最大计数值为 0000H ,此时的计数初值为_10000D二、选择题1 判断两个无符号数加法运算是否溢出的标志是_D_A. ZF ;B. SF;C. CF;D. OF2 8086CPI在计算物理地
4、址时,应将段地址C。A. 左移1位;B.右移1位;C.左移4位;D.右移4位3 INTEL 8088/8086 CPU 由D_组成。A 通用寄存器、专用寄存器和 ALU;B. ALU FR及8个16位通用寄存器C CS、ES SS DS及 IP、指令队列;D EU 和 BIU4 .下列4种描述中正确的是_B_。A 汇编语言只由指令语句构成。B 汇编语言语句包括指令语句和伪指令语句和宏指令语句。C 指令语句和伪指令语句都能经汇编程序翻译成机器代码。D 指令语句和伪指令语句都不能经汇编程序翻译成机器代码。5. 已知内存单元(20510H =31H (20511H =32H (30510H =42H
5、 (30511H =43H 且 AX= 3A7BH DS=2000H,SS=3000H, BP = 0500H,则执行 MOV AL, BP+10H后 AX= DA. 3A31H B. 3231H C. 427BH D. 3A42H6. 一微机系统采用一片8259A若8259A设置为普通全嵌套、非缓冲、非自动中断结束等方式,并将ICW2设置为08H 各中断源的优先权是(1) C ,IR5引脚上中断源的中断类型码为(2) D,该中断源的中断服务程序入口地址应存于中断向量表中首址为(3) C 的4个单元内。(1) A自动循环B 固定不变,IR7优先权最高,IR0优先权最低C固定不变,IR0优先权最
6、高,IR7优先权最低D由程序设定,可设置IRi优先权最高(2) A 05H B 08H C 0DH D 0FH(3) A 05H B 14H C 24H D 34H7 8253通道1外接100 KHz的时钟信号,按十进制计数,则当写入计数器的初值为 5000H时,定时时间为 (1) C ; 若按二进制计数,定时10ms,则写入的计数初值为(2) A 。(1) A 5ms B 50 ms C 204.8 msD 20.48ms(2) A 1000H B 0100H C 0064H D 03E8H8、循环指令LOO的退出条件是 C。A AX=0B BX=0C CX= 0D CX= 19、 8086
7、/8088系统中用于形成地址总线的器件是A 。A缓冲器;B 锁存器; C)计数器;D) 译码器10、8088/8086 CPU的基本总线周期由 B时钟周期组成。A 2 ; B 4 ; C 5 ; D 611、 在8086系统中中断号为0AH则存放中断向量的内存起始地址为B _ °A 0AH; B 28H ; C 4AH ; D 2AH12、80X86 CPU各累加器AX的内容清零的正确指令是_B_。A AND AX, AX B XOR AX , AXC OR AX, AX D. NOT AX13、下列器件可作简单输入接口的电路是_(1) _ A _,作简单输出接口的电路是_ (2)
8、_ B。A三态缓冲器;B 锁存器;C反相器; D 译码器14、某微机最大可寻址的内存空间为16MB其CPU地址总线至少应有 _D。A 32 ; B 16; C 20; D 2415、伪指令VAR DW ?将在内存预留的存储空间是_B_。A. 1字节 B . 2字节C. 6字节D. 4字节16、关系运算符EQ NE LT、GT LE、GE等,当运算结果关系成立时汇编返回_A_。A. 0FFFFH B . 0000HC. 0001HD . 1000H17、8、8086 CPU寻址I/O端口最多使用_D_条地址线。A 8 ; B 10 ; C 12 ; D 1618、8086/8088系统中用于形成
9、地址总线的器件是_AA缓冲器;B 锁存器; C)计数器;D) 译码器19、某微机最大可寻址的内存空间为16MB其CPU地址总线至少应有_D。A 32 ; B 16; C 20; D 2415、两数比较,若相等时转移到LABEL的指令是_A_OA JZ LABEL ; B JC LABEL ;C JO LABEL ; D JS LABEL16、下列信号中_C来区分CPU访问内存储器或I/O接口。A WR; B RD ;C M / IO ; D DT /R17.8086存储信息的基本单位是_BA. 字 B .字节 C . KB D . MB 18.8086的字长有_C_位。A . 32 B. 16
10、 C. 8D.6419.8086有4个通用数据寄存器,其中AX除用做通用寄存器外,还可用做_A_>A.累加器B .计数器 C .基址寄存器D. 段地址寄存器20、设寄存器BX存有一偏移地址,则对应内存单元的物理地址应在 _A_,A.数据段 B .代码段C.附加段 D .堆栈段21、设寄存器BP存有一偏移地址,则对应内存单元的物理地址应在 _D_>A.数据段 B .代码段C.附加段 D .堆栈段 22.8086有20根地址线,直接寻址空间为_B_。A. 64 MB B . 1 MBC. 1024 KB D . 8MB23. 标志寄存器中PF=1时,表示 A oA. 运算结果低8位中所
11、含1的个数为奇数B. 运算结果低8位中所含1的个数为偶数C. 运算结果有溢出D. 运算结果无溢出24. 地址加法器是属于_B_中部件。A. EU B . BIU C . ALU D .指令队列25. 立即、直接、寄存器间接3种寻址方式,指令的执行速度,由快至慢的排序为 _C A .直接、立即、间接B .直接、间接、立即C .立即、直接、间接D.不一定26. 指令MOV AL BX中的源操作数在_A_中。A 数据段B 附加段C.堆栈段D 代码段27. 指令ADD AX SI+50H中,源操作数的寻址方式是_DA 变址寻址B 基址和变址寻址C 基址寻址D.变址相对寻址28. 指令MOV AX DA
12、T1BXF DI中,源操作数的寻址方式是 _DA .变址寻址B .基址和变址寻址C .基址寻址 D .基址变址相对寻址29. 将累加器AX的内容清零,错误的指令是 _B亠A . XOR AX AX B. AND AX OC . SUB AX AX D. CMP AX AX32. 伪指令VAR DW ?将在内存预留的存储空间是B_oA . 1字节 B . 2字节C. 6字节D . 4字节33. 伪指令BUF DB 20 DUP(Q 1)在内存中占用的存储空间是_D_。A. 80字节B . 20字节C. 60字节D. 40字节34. 语句MOV BX OFFSET DA执行后,BX存放的是_B_。
13、A . DAT的段地址 B.DAT1的偏移地址C . DAT的第1个数据D. DAT1的物理地址36. DO功能调用时,功能号应放入_ C 中。A . AX B. AL C. AH D. DX三、简答题(每小题5分,共15分)1、冯.诺依曼计算机的基本设计思想是什么?(1) 计算机应用由运算器、控制器、存储器、输入和输出设备等五大部分组成。(2) 存储器不但能存放数据,也能存放程序.计算机具有区分指令和数据的能力。而且数据和指令均以二进制形式 存放。(3) 将事先编好的程序存入存储器中,在指令计数器控制下,自动高速运行(执行程序)。2、8088CPI和8086CPU吉构的区别。(1) 8088
14、指令队列长度是4个字节,8086是6个字节。(2) 8088的BIU内数据总线宽度是 8位,而EU内数据总线宽度是 16位,这样对16位数的存储器读/写操 作需要两个读/写周期才能完成。8086的BIU和EU内数据总线宽度都是16位。(3) 8088外部数据总线只有8条AD7- AD0即内部是16位,对外是8位,故8088也称为准16位机。3、8086CPU构成系统时其存储器可分为哪两个存储体?它们如何与地址、数据总线连接?8086CPU勾成系统时,其存储器可分为奇地址存储体与偶地址存储体。 偶地址存储体的8位数据线,与CPU1竝数据总 线的D7D(连接;奇地址存储体的8位数据线与CPU1竝数
15、据总线的D15D8连接。地址总线A19A1提供存储体片选的 高位地址,A0和BHE(HE有上划线)区分奇偶地址存储体。4、8086/8088 CPU系统为什么要采用地址锁存器?因为8086/8088的AD15AD0/AD7A既可作为低16位/8位地址线,又可作为16位/8位数据线,为了把地址信息分离 出来保存,外接存储器或外设提供16位/8位地址信息,一般须外加三态锁存器,并由CPLT生的地址锁存允许信号ALE 的下跳变将地址信息锁存入8282/8283锁存器中。5、计算机系统要完成一次外部中断,需要经历哪几个过程?(1) 中断请求。中断源产生中断请求的条件对不同中断源是不同的。(2) 中断判
16、优。由于中断产生的随机性,可能同时提出多个中断源,此时就要根据中断源的轻重缓急,给它们确定 一个中断级别。(3)中断响应。对可屏蔽中断,仅有中断请求是不行的。除优先级别高低的条件外,CPU内正有中断允许触发器,只有当其为“ 1 “时,CPU才能响应可屏蔽中断。(4)中断处理。由中断服务程序完成。保护环境,开中断,执行中断服务程序,关中断,恢复现场(5)中断返回。执行返回指令后,CPU会自动弹出断点信息,送给指令指针,并恢复标志寄存器的内容,以便回到 断点出处继续执行原程序。6. 试简述以8086 CPU为核心的最小系统的构成。答:计算机硬件系统主要由CPU存储器、I/O接口、I/O设备构成,它
17、们由总线(控制总线、地址总线和数据总线) 连接。对于以8086 CPU为核心的最小系统,还应包括一片时钟发生器、3片8282地址锁存器和2片8286数据驱动器。四、存储器(2小题,共20分)1、某微机系统有24条地址线。欲用2KX 4 b的RAM芯片构成32 KB的存储系统,问:1)需要多少片这样的芯片? 2) 每个芯片的地址线有几条? 3)至少需要多少条地址线用作片外地址译码?(本小题 9分)1)需要 32x8/ (2x4) =322)11 条3)4条 2、用二片6264芯片组成的8位微机存储器系统的电路如图所示。(设地址总线为16位。)(本小题11分)1)说明存储器芯片类型,并计算# 1和
18、# 2的存储容量是多大;(5分)2)分析# 1芯片和# 2芯片的地址范围(需给出具体地址分配表)。(6分)CS ArrA ICRTa VF':Ta 11 tKIi 一1131) #1和#2的容量均为:2 *8=8KB2 )设A15为0#1的地址范围为:4000H-5FFFH.#2的地址范围为:2000H-3FFFH.(本小题8分)3、某微机系统采用16位地址总线,部分存储器与CPU!接图如下图所示,要求:(1)写出存储器芯片的容量。(2分(2) 要求完成系统硬件连线图及引脚标注,并标出信号传送方向。(2分)(3) 写出芯片的地址范围,若有地址重叠,请写出基本地址范围。(4分)UMMl
19、-M 丹J $-avkFi.pv-w|iliBJ i济p门Will,巴I.=' tJ-1 兴'j wFt1) ROM有 12根地址线(A11A0 :2A12=4kb。两片形成8kb容量RAM有 11跟地址线:2A1仁2kb.两片形成4kb容量3)ROM 1)地址范围:8000H8FFFHRO(2): 9000H9FFFHRAM( 1): A000HAFFFHRAM( 2): B000HBFFFHRAM区有地址重叠:A000HA7FFHA8FFHAFFFHB000HB7FFHB8FFHBFFFHRAMI( 1)基本地址范围(A11= 0时)重叠地址范围(A11=1时)RAM( 2
20、)基本地址范围(A11= 0时)重叠地址范围(A11=1时)五、程序分析及设计(除了题中单独标注的题分,其余每空1分,共25分)1、以下程序片段执行前(AX =1234H (BX =5678HMOV CL,4MOV DH,BHSHL BX,CLMOV DL,AHSHL AX,CLSHR DH,CLOR AL,DHSHR DL,CLOR BL,DL执行完该片段后(AX = 2345H、( BX = 6781H。2、程序段如下:X DB 65HY DB 0F3HMOV AL, XMOV BL, YCMP AL,BLJGE NEXTXCHG AL,BLNEXT: HLT 程序执行后,AL= 65H;
21、 BL= 03FH .比较变量X和Y两个有符号数的大小,将大者放入 AL,小者放入BL中2、程序段如下:MOV AL,23HMOV AH, 0Again: AND AL ,ALJZ STPSHL AL, 1JNC Agai nINC AHJMP Agai nSTP: HLT1)程序的功能是(本小题2分):对AL中“1”的个数进行统计,并放入AH中2)程序执行后,AH= 33 程序段如下:MOV AL BYTE PTR XMOV CL,4SHL AL, CLDEC ALMOV BYTE PTR ,AL程序执行后,完成运算的算术表达式应是Y=Xx2-4;其中,程序段指令中出现的X,Y其类型为 变量
22、类型4、阅读下列程序DAT/SEGMENTBUF DB 32H, 75H, 0C9H, 85H;共4个数据RESULT DB ?DATA ENDSCODE SEGMENTASSUME CS : CODE, DS DATASTART MOV AX DATAMOV DS AXLEA SI , BUFMOV CX 4MOV BX 0LP1:MOV DH 8MOV AL SILP2:ROR AL 1JC NEXTINC BXNEXT DEC DHJNE LP2INC SILOOP LP1MOV RESULTBXMOV AH 4CHINT 21HCODE ENDSEND START(1) 本程序段的功能
23、是_统计缓冲区BUF中4个单字节二进制数中的0的个数(2) 程序执行完变量RESULT= 11 H4 画出数据段中数据定义语句实现的内存分配图。DATASEGMENT AT 1415HORG 2000HBLOCK DB 00H , 80H, 0FEH 0A8H 90HCOUNT EQU $ BLOCKFLAGDB 1DATAENDS内存分配图(本小题4分):5 以下程序段完成的功能是:把内存单元两数进行相加,结果送回到内存单元中。请根据注释要求对程序进行完善。DAT SEGMENT定义数据段,以DAT为段名ADD-BUF DB 51100定义ADD_BU变量空间,含两个字节类型数值 51, 1
24、00SUM-BUF DB?定义SUM_BU变量空间,只分配1个字节型单元,数值不定DAT ENDS ;段定义结束CODE SEGMENTASSUME CS:CODE, DS:DAT ;对两个段类型进行汇编说明START: MOV AX,DAT 2句语句完成DS初始化MOV DS,AX;MOV AH,ADD_BUFADD AH,ADD_BUF+1MOV SUM_BUF,AHINT 20H; 一条语句返回DOSCODE ENDSEND START;汇编结束,初始化 CS IP把该源程序命名为:SUM.ASM对其进行汇编,需要利MASM命令生成目标文件SUM.OBJ再利用LINK 命令生 成可执行文件SUM.EXE在调试环境下运行SUM.EX文件,应在DOS境下输入命令 DEBUG6 以下程序功能是:对内存中的二个无符号字节数进行比较,把大数存放在内存MAX单元中。请根据注释进行程序完善。DATA SEGMENT ;数据段开始SOURCE DB X1 X2 ;定义X1和X2为二个无符号字节数MAX DB?;定义结果存放的单元MAX为空字节DATA ENDS ;数据段结束CODE SEGMENT;定义代码段ASSUME CS : CODE DS DATA ;设定段寄存器BIGIN: MOV AX DATA 将 DATA偏移地址通过
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 2025年中国冰冷热上流式瓶装机市场调查研究报告
- 2025年中国公文箱市场调查研究报告
- 植物与土壤微生物的相互作用试题及答案
- 2025年度新能源电池研发中心工程师劳动合同书
- 2025年中国仿真砂岩喷泉市场调查研究报告
- 五年级上册数学教案-7 解决问题的策略2-苏教版
- 2025年中国二十四路数字直播调音台市场调查研究报告
- 2025年中国不锈钢卫生级快装三通数据监测报告
- 2025年中国万向盘市场调查研究报告
- 2025年中国VC果味软糖项目投资可行性研究报告
- 国开2024《人文英语4》边学边练参考答案
- 质量手册(质量保证手册,压力容器)
- 6.1 感知数字媒体技术-【中职专用】高一信息技术同步课堂(高教版2021·基础模块下册)
- MOOC 信号与系统-西安邮电大学 中国大学慕课答案
- 新疆维吾尔自治区普通高校学生转学申请(备案)表
- 二人合伙投资生意合同
- 美容美体艺术专业人才培养方案(中职)
- 第二单元《认识多位数》(单元测试)-2023-2024学年苏教版数学四年级下册
- 山西旅游路线设计方案
- 化学纤维行业操作人员安全培训要点
- 卵巢癌诊治指南乐翔课件
评论
0/150
提交评论